»The Stillness«

by Esther Odendaal

It is in the stillness
That I can truly see
The beauty of my life
The wonder that is me
Not that I would boast
For no one needs to hear
What's happening inside
For I am losing fear
Far too long I've heard
What others think of me
I want to shut that out
And learn to simply be
Now I hold the mirror
To see what I can see
Learn more of the gifts
My God has given me

It is in the stillness
That I can truly see
Break the ties that bind
Let myself be free
Let go of all the pain
Release all thoughts of shame
Rid myself of guilt
Be free of all the blame
For each of us is here
To find what lies within
Not what others think
Or judge what seems a sin
What comes to us in life
Is brought for us to learn
And each must learn alone
And our own fingers burn

It is in the stillness
That I can truly see
The lessons I have learned
And what they mean to me
It's not what others think
It's not what I've been taught
I've seen my greatest 'sin'
Is doing what I ought
My God has made each one
With spirit that is true
To honour this in each
Is what we all must do
This will bring the stillness
And fill us with the grace
Make all we say and do
The world a peaceful place.
